    The Night Shift is an American medical drama television series that ran on NBC from May 27, 2014, to August 31, 2017, for four seasons and 45 episodes. [1] [2] The series was created by Gabe Sachs and Jeff Judah , and follows the lives of the staff who work the late night shift in the emergency room at San Antonio Memorial Hospital.
